About 6 Ashton Road
6 Ashton Road is a four-bedroom detached house in Bournemouth (BH9 2TN). It has a recorded floor area of 121 m² (around 1302 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(February 2015)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 81),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from February 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
At 121 m² the property is well over the postcode median (83 m² across 12 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Across 2007–2015, sale prices on this property compounded at 2.3%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£445,000 is 28.2% above the 2015 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£266/sq ft) was about 33.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last changed hands 11 years ago, in June 2015.
